在计算机使用过程中,我们可能会遇到需要修改文件修改时间的情况。这可能是因为我们想要隐藏某些文件的历史记录,或者是为了满足某些软件的特殊要求。以下是一些实用的技巧,可以帮助你轻松地修改文件目录中所有文件的修改时间。
一、使用Windows命令行
Windows系统中,我们可以使用cmd命令行工具来批量修改文件时间。
打开命令提示符:按下
Win + R,输入cmd,回车打开命令提示符。定位到目标文件夹:使用
cd命令进入目标文件夹。执行命令:使用以下命令修改所有文件的最后修改时间:
for /r %i in (*) do powershell (Get-Item %i).LastWriteTime = (Get-Date).AddDays(-1)这条命令会将当前文件夹及其子文件夹中所有文件的最后修改时间修改为一天前。
修改创建和访问时间:如果你还想修改文件的创建时间和最后访问时间,可以使用以下命令:
for /r %i in (*) do ( $item = Get-Item %i $item.CreationTime = (Get-Date).AddDays(-1) $item.LastAccessTime = (Get-Date).AddDays(-1) )
二、使用第三方软件
除了Windows自带的命令行工具外,还有一些第三方软件可以帮助你批量修改文件时间。
H2testw:这是一个文件校验工具,但也可以用来修改文件时间。下载并安装后,运行程序,选择“File”菜单中的“File Operations”,然后选择“Change Date/Time”。
File Alteration Tool:这是一个免费的文件属性修改工具,包括修改文件时间。下载并安装后,选择目标文件夹,然后选择“Change File Time”功能进行修改。
三、使用图形界面工具
如果你更喜欢图形界面,也有一些图形界面工具可以帮助你批量修改文件时间。
FileTime:这是一个简单的图形界面工具,可以修改文件的创建、修改和访问时间。下载并安装后,选择目标文件夹,然后进行修改。
File properties Changer:这是一个功能更强大的图形界面工具,除了修改文件时间外,还可以修改文件大小、属性等。下载并安装后,选择目标文件夹,然后选择“Change Date”功能进行修改。
总结
通过以上方法,你可以轻松地修改文件目录中所有文件的修改时间。不过需要注意的是,修改文件时间可能会对某些软件产生影响,所以在修改之前请确保清楚了解自己的需求。
